夏枯草提取物、芦丁和槲皮素体外生物活性对比研究
Comparative Study on Biological Activities of Prunella vulgaris Extract,Rutin and Querce-tin in vitro
摘要
Abstract
[Objective]Extract storage and preservation of substances from traditional Chinese medicinal materials is an important direction in the field of agricultural product processing research.This study aimed to analyze the antioxidant capacity and antibacterial effect of Prunella vulgaris ex-tract,rutin and quercetin in vitro,and to provide a scientific basis for application of natural plant re-sources in preservation of agricultural products and development of functional foods.[Method]Four in vitro antioxidant assessment methods(DPPH,PTIO,ABTS free radical scavenging test,FRAP method)and Oxford cup antibacterial test were used to comprehensively analyze the differences in biological activities of the 3 substances.Vitamin C(VC)was used as the reference reagent in the in vitro antioxidant assessment,and the results were expressed as VC equivalent mg VCE/g.[Result]In the DPPH free radical scavenging assay,quercetin showed the highest scavenging effect(184.06 mg VCE/g),which was significantly higher than that of rutin(118.46 mg VCE/g)and Prunella vul-garis extract(6.69 mg VCE/g).There was no significant difference between quercetin and rutin(444.07 mg VCE/g and 469.37 mg VCE/g,respectively)in the PITO free radical scavenging assay,but both of them showed significantly higher effects than Prunella vulgaris extract(100.55 mg VCE/g).In the ABTS free radical scavenging assay,there was no significant difference between querce-tin(61.56 mg VCE/g)and rutin(58.11 mg VCE/g),but both of them showed significantly higher effexts than Prunella vulgaris(100.55 mg VCE/g).FRAP assay further confirmed that quercetin(1.06 mmol/L FeSO4)had the strongest iron reducing ability,which was not significantly different from that of rutin,but significantly higher than that of Prunella vulgaris extract(0.54 mmol/L Fe-SO4).Antibacterial test result showed that the inhibition zone diameters of rutin,quercetin and Prunella vulgaris extract against Staphylococcus aureus were 10.48 mm,9.98 mm and 10.30 mm,respectively,and those against Escherichia coli were 10.69 mm,9.82 mm and 10.41 mm,respec-tively.There was no significant difference among the 3 substances.[Conclusion]Quercetin has high antioxidant activity and the strongest iron ion reducing ability in vitro,but there was no significant difference in the antibacterial effect on Staphylococcus aureus and Escherichia coli among rutin,quercetin and Prunella vulgaris extract.关键词
